The name Shevaun has been used with varying frequency over the years in the United States, according to available birth records from 1956 to 1990. The earliest year on record for this name was 1956, with a total of five births that year. The trend continued with another five births recorded in 1967.
However, there was an increase in the number of babies named Shevaun in subsequent years, reaching six births each in both 1968 and 1971. Then, in the late 1970s to early 1980s, we observed a peak with nine births in 1978, ten births in 1980, and eleven births in 1981.
After this peak period, the popularity of the name Shevaun seemed to decrease again. There were five births each in 1982 and 1986, followed by six births in both 1983 and 1987, and finally five births in 1988 and six in 1990.
In total, over the span of these years, there were 105 babies named Shevaun born in the United States. These statistics provide an insight into the usage trends of this particular name during that period.
